Williamsburg Native Italian Earth Oil Colors
 
Italian Terra Verte #6000013
PG 23 - Natural Ferrous Silicate containing Mangnesium and Aluminum Potassium Silicates
 Transparent /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
The true Brentonica earth. Semi-transparent, slightly gritty, with a velvet-like, soft, light-absorbing surface. A delicate green. Not an opaque, olive or yellowish green. Giorgione's green.

Italian Lemon Ochre #6000014
PY 43 - Natural Hydrated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
A light clear bright yellow. Almost too luminous to call ochre. It glows like the Italian light.

Italian Yellow Ochre #6000015
PY 43 - Natural Hydrated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
Rich, clean, and brilliant. One is reminded of Sassetta's landscapes or Renaissance illuminated manuscripts.

Italian Orange Ochre #6000016
PBr 7 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
PY 43 - Natural Hydrated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
A very beautiful deep ochre. The depth is evident in the reddish undertones as opposed to a brownish quality. Genuine Flesh Ochre.

Italian Green Ochre #6000017
PBr 7 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
PY 43 - Natural Hydrated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
A wonderful color like fresh rattan or tobacco leaves. Not like terra-verte, but a musky, greenish gold.

Italian Pompeii Red #6000018
PR 102 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
The true, intense, brilliant red of ancient Italian frescoes. Hot, glowing, and luminous.

Italian Rosso Veneto #6000019
PR 102 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
Mined in the Veneto region, a true Venetian red with no orange undertones. a clean, cool, pinkish quality.

Italian Pozzuoli Earth #6000020
PR 102 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
Warmer than Rosso Veneto with some orange undertones - earthy and rich. Favored by Uccello.

Italian Terra Rosa #6000021
PR 102 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
Similar to Pozzuoli Earth, but stronger and earthier. The orange undertone becomes quite pronounced.

Italian Black Roman Earth #6000022
PBr 7 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ide containing Manganese
PBk 6 - Nearly Pure Amorphous Carbon
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
A semi-transparent blackish earth that acts like Cassell earth though cooler and blacker. Wonderful for mixing and perfect for glazing. Very subtle. Great pigment for wash drawings. Better than bitumen or asphaltum.

Italian Burnt Sienna #6000023
PBr 7 - Calcined Natural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
Higher pitched and somewhat brighter than our other Burnt Sienna - also, it's slightly warmer.

Italian Raw Sienna #6000024
PY 43 - Natural Hydrated Iron Oxide
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
This is the beautiful semi-transparent golden Italian Earth used by the Renaissance masters. The slight gritty quality allows for exquisite undertones.

Italian Raw Umber #6000025
PBr 7 - Natural Iron Oxide containing Manganese
 Semi-Opaque / Lightfastness: I - Excellent
At one time we were able to get what we considered to be a "perfect" raw umber. Unfortunately the main facility in Cyprus burned down. After testing pigments from all over the world we found this pigment from our source in Italy. If ever there was a "perfect" raw umber - this is it
